Tinker Tailor Soldier Spy (02:04 – 12:23)
Gary Oldman is a retired spy who returns to investigate a potential mole within the upper echelon of British Intellegence. Based on the 1974 novel by John le Carré, the film also stars Colin Firth, Tom Hardy, John Hurt and Mark Strong. The film is currently in wide release in theaters in North America.

Choplifter HD (35:40 -45:36 )
Choplifter HD is a remake of the original Choplifter arcade game released back in 1982. We took a look at the game on the Xbox Live Arcade but it is also available for Windows and the PlayStation 3.

Moneyball (01:37 – 11:11)
Based on the book of the same time, Moneyball is the true story of the Oakland A’s attempt to reinvent the game of baseball after their star players move on to other teams all while contending with one of the league’s smallest budgets. Directed by Bennett Miller and starring Brad Pitt and Jonah Hill, the film is available on DVD and BluRay as of January 10.

The Ides of March (13:05 – 27:27)
Ryan Gosling plays a young, ambitious campaign manager for George Clooney, a Pennsylvania Governor making his way to the White House. The film was directed by George Clooney and also stars Philip Seymour Hoffman, Paul Giamatti and Evan Rachel Wood. It was released in theaters back in October, and you still may find it there, but it will be released on DVD and BluRay on January 17.
